Littles Construction Co Salary

As of July 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Littles Construction Co in the United States is $94,014.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$45. Salaries at Littles Construction Co typically range from $82,829 to $106,099 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Marysville?

Understanding the cost of living near Marysville is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Littles Construction Co.
Marysville (Snohomish Co.) Cost of Living Index is approx. 115-120. North of Everett, growing, housing above US avg. Community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Littles Construction Co,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,500 - $2,200+ A significant portion of Littles Construction Co sal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$110 - $200 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$99 (ORCA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$450 - $670 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$730+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$390 - $720+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,949 - $4,529+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
